• 제목/요약/키워드: Virtual Environments

검색결과 769건 처리시간 0.024초

현실환경과 가상 환경을 연동하는 맥락 인식 기반 U-VR 시뮬레이터 (Context-aware U-VR Simulator for Linking Real and Virtual Environments)

  • 오유수;강창구;우운택
    • 한국HCI학회:학술대회논문집
    • /
    • 한국HCI학회 2009년도 학술대회
    • /
    • pp.310-314
    • /
    • 2009
  • 본 논문에서는 유비쿼터스 가상 현실 개념에 기반하여 맥락 정보를 이용하여 현실과 가상 환경을 이음매 없이 연결하는 U-VR 시뮬레이터를 제안한다. U-VR 시뮬레이터는 스마트 홈 환경을 시뮬레이션 할 수 있고, 센서, 액추에이터, 서비스와 같은 새로운 가상 개체들을 기존의 실제 개체에 추가할 수 있게 한다. 제안된 시뮬레이터는 기존의 장치와 시뮬레이션 할 장치를 동시에 활용함으로써 빠른 개발과 비용 절감의 효과가 있다. 또한, 제안된 시뮬레이터는 어플리케이션 개발자들이 유비쿼터스 가상 현실 응용을 쉽고 빠르게 개발하고, 적절한 도메인으로 확장하게 한다. 추후 연구로는 제안된 시뮬레이터가 현실 환경에 가상의 개체들을 지능적으로 증강하도록 확장할 것이다.

  • PDF

과학적 탐구학습을 지원하는 가상현실 시스템 개발에 관한 연구 (The Development of the Virtual Reality System for Augmenting Scientific Inquiry Learning Environments)

  • 임재원;김석환;조용주;박경신
    • 정보처리학회논문지B
    • /
    • 제15B권2호
    • /
    • pp.95-102
    • /
    • 2008
  • 상호작용적인 가상현실 기술은 실제 환경의 제약을 극복할 수 있으며 사용자에게 흥미와 적극적인 참여를 유도하여 과학적 탐구학습에도 적극 활용되고 있다. 그러나 기존 연구에서는 주로 특정 교안에 대한 응용 프로그램의 개발에 중점을 두고 있어서 다른 교안을 위한 탐구학습가상환경 개발에 쉽게 활용하기 어려웠다. 이에 본 연구에서는 과학적 탐구학습 가상환경의 개발을 도와주는 통합적인 가상현실 시스템 SASILE (System for Augmenting Scientific Inquiry Learning Environments)을 개발하였다. 본 논문에서는 먼저 가상현실을 활용한 과학적 탐구학습 관련 연구를 살펴보고, 제안하는 시스템의 구조와 구현에 대해서 설명한다. 그리고 이 시스템을 이용하여 가상현실 모양성에서 한옥에 나타난 대류현상에 대한 과학적 탐구학습 환경 개발 사례와 가상환경 화성 암석의 성분을 측정하여 운석이 떨어진 곳을 찾는 화성 탐사 개발사례를 설명한다. 마지막으로 이 시스템의 향후 연구 방향에 대해 논한다.

유아의 공간감각 향상을 위한 가상학습공간 구축 (Virtual learning environments for improving spatial sense of young children)

  • 차은미;김현주;이경미;이정욱;김은정;이소정;홍은주
    • 한국콘텐츠학회:학술대회논문집
    • /
    • 한국콘텐츠학회 2006년도 추계 종합학술대회 논문집
    • /
    • pp.783-787
    • /
    • 2006
  • 공간감각은 주위 환경과 그 환경에서의 물체에 대한 직관적 느낌으로, 유아기는 이러한 공간감각의 기초능력이 발달되는 매우 중요한 시기이다. 유아들은 공간에 대한 직접적이고 능동적인 탐색을 통해 공간감각을 발달시켜 나가므로, 신체적인 움직임을 통해 공간을 탐색하는 경험은 공간감각 향상에 필수적이다. 본 논문에서는 동작을 이용한 유아의 공간감각 계발을 위해 4가지 콘텐츠를 제안한다: 물방울게임, 골키퍼 게임, 웅덩이를 피하기, 도형 맞추기. 제안된 4가지 콘텐츠는 보다 넓은 공간을 활용한 활동을 제공하기 위해서 가상 학습 공간으로 구현되었다. 또한, 구현된 가상학습공간에는 유아의 행동을 인지하여 가상학습공간의 콘텐츠를 이용할 수 있는 실감형 인터페이스를 적용하고 있다. 유아들의 행동에 바탕을 둔 실감형 인터페이스를 사용하는 것은 유아들에게 공간감각 형성에 도움을 줄 뿐만 아니라, 학습에 대한 즐거움, 흥미를 제공하게 되는 매우 중요한 역할을 수행하게 된다.

  • PDF

An Efficient Load Balancing Mechanism in Distributed Virtual Environments

  • Jang, Su-Min;Yoo, Jae-Soo
    • ETRI Journal
    • /
    • 제30권4호
    • /
    • pp.618-620
    • /
    • 2008
  • A distributed virtual environment (DVE) allows multiple geographically distributed objects to interact concurrently in a shared virtual space. Most DVE applications use a non-replicated server architecture, which dynamically partitions a virtual space. An important issue in this system is effective scalability as the number of users increases. However, it is hard to provide suitable load balancing because of the unpredictable movements of users and hot-spot locations. Therefore, we propose a mechanism for sharing roles and separating service regions. The proposed mechanism reduces unnecessary partitions of short duration and supports efficient load balancing.

  • PDF

ID-based group key exchange mechanism for virtual group with microservice

  • Kim, Hyun-Jin;Park, Pyung-Koo;Ryou, Jae-Cheol
    • ETRI Journal
    • /
    • 제43권5호
    • /
    • pp.932-940
    • /
    • 2021
  • Currently, research on network functions virtualization focuses on using microservices in cloud environments. Previous studies primarily focused on communication between nodes in physical infrastructure. Until now, there is no sufficient research on group key management in virtual environments. The service is composed of microservices that change dynamically according to the virtual service. There are dependencies for microservices on changing the group membership of the service. There is also a high possibility that various security threats, such as data leakage, communication surveillance, and privacy exposure, may occur in interactive communication with microservices. In this study, we propose an ID-based group key exchange (idGKE) mechanism between microservices as one group. idGKE defines the microservices' schemes: group key gen, join group, leave group, and multiple group join. We experiment in a real environment to evaluate the performance of the proposed mechanism. The proposed mechanism ensures an essential requirement for group key management such as secrecy, sustainability, and performance, improving virtual environment security.

XML을 이용한 3D 가상 제품의 HMI 행동양태 모델링과 시뮬레이션 방안 (Modeling and Simulation of HMI Behaviors of 3D Virtual Products using XML)

  • 정호균;박형준
    • 한국CDE학회논문집
    • /
    • 제20권1호
    • /
    • pp.75-83
    • /
    • 2015
  • In the virtual prototyping (VP) of digital products, it is important to provide the people involved in product development with the visualization and interaction of the products, and the simulation of their human machine interaction (HMI) behaviors in interactive 3D virtual environments. Especially, for the HMI behavior simulation, it is necessary to represent them properly and to play them back effectively according to user interaction in the virtual environments. In a conventional approach to HMI behavior simulation, user interface (UI) designers use UI design software tools to generate the HMI behavior of a digital product of interest. Due to lack of reusability of the HMI behavior, VP developers need to analyze and integrate it into a VP system for its simulation in a 3D virtual environment. As this approach hinders the effective communication between the UI designers and the VP developers, it is easy to create errors and thereby it takes significant time and effort especially when it is required to represent the HMI behavior to the finest level of detail. In order to overcome the shortcomings of the conventional approach, we propose an approach for representing the HMI behavior of a digital product using XML (eXtensible Markup Language) and for reusing it to perform the HMI behavior simulation in 3D virtual environments. Based on the approach, a VP system has been developed and applied for the design evaluation of various products. A case study about the design evaluation is given to show the usefulness of the proposed approach.

가상현실 게임에서의 시각화와 몰입도의 상관관계 (Relationship with Visualization and Immersion in Virtual Reality Games)

  • 최민수;박준
    • 한국컴퓨터게임학회논문지
    • /
    • 제31권4호
    • /
    • pp.121-128
    • /
    • 2018
  • 가상현실은 사용자에게 현실 세계와 분리된 환경을 구현하는 기술이며, 분리된 환경을 구현하기 위해서 몰입도가 중요한 요소로 자리 잡고 있다. 하지만 이와 같은 분리된 환경으로 인해서 주변 환경에 대한 인식의 부족이 불안정한 가상현실 게임 환경으로 이어질 수 있기 때문에 이를 해결하기 위해서 다양한 연구들이 진행되고 있다. 대부분의 연구가 시각화를 통해 문제를 해결하는 것에 집중하고 있다. 한편, 시각화는 일반적으로 가상현실의 공간과는 관계가 없는 정보이기 때문에 이것이 적용되는 가상현실의 몰입도에 미치는 영향에 대한 연구가 필요하다. 몰입도는 개인마다 성향 차이가 있으며, 몰입도에 영향을 끼치는 요소들이 다양하기 때문에 이를 고려한 가이드라인이 필요하다. 본 논문에서는 이 두 가지 문제를 해결하기 위해서 몰입도 성향에 따른 설문과 주변 환경에 대한 정보를 시각화하여 전달하는 두 개의 시스템에 대한 실험을 진행하고자 한다. 개인의 몰입도 성향을 측정하고, 이를 성향별로 구분지어 시각화가 가상현실 게임에 미치는 영향을 확인하여 이 결과를 통해 개인의 몰입도 성향에 따른 가상현실 게임 환경 조성에 대한 가이드라인을 제시하고자 한다.

가상환경에서 VDU와 HMD에 대한 생리학적 영향에 관한 연구 (Physiological Effects of the VDU & HMD in Virtual Environments)

  • 이창민;박시현
    • 산업공학
    • /
    • 제16권2호
    • /
    • pp.149-155
    • /
    • 2003
  • The focus of this study is to investigate how personal display systems - a VDU (Visual Display Unit) and an HMD (Head Mounted Display) physiologically affect the body in virtual environments, and to evaluate differential effects of using the VDU and the HMD on physiological responses to mental stressful tasks (virtual reality flight simulation). As physiological variables, autonomic measures (heart rate, blood pressure), immune cells (leukocyte, neutrophil, lymphocyte), and hormones (catecholamine) were measured before and after experiments. Physiological data were measured in order to compare a level of mental stress on the VDU and the HMD. Increments in blood pressure (systolic (p<0.05), diastolic (p<0.1)), norepinephrin (catecholamine) (p<0.005), and neutrophils (p<0.2) of the group using the HMD showed a significant difference with the group using the VDU. Although, the heart rate was not statistically significant between two environments, differences of them quietly increased on the HMD more than on the VDU.

A Simulation Model of Object Movement for Evaluating the Communication Load in Networked Virtual Environments

  • Lim, Mingyu;Lee, Yunjin
    • Journal of Information Processing Systems
    • /
    • 제9권3호
    • /
    • pp.489-498
    • /
    • 2013
  • In this paper, we propose a common simulation model that can be reused for different performance evaluations of networked virtual environments. To this end, we analyzed the common features of NVEs, in which multiple regions compose a shared space, and where a user has his/her own interest area. Communication architecture can be client-server or peer-server models. In usual simulations, users move around the world while the number of users varies with the system. Our model provides various simulation parameters to customize the region configuration and user movement pattern. Furthermore, our model introduces a way to mimic a lot of users in a minimal experiment environment. The proposed model is integrated with our network framework, which supports various scalability approaches. We specifically applied our model to the interest management and load distribution schemes to evaluate communication overhead. With the proposed simulation model, a new simulation can be easily designed in a large-scale environment.

틸팅차량의 네트워크 협업 엔진 구현 (Implementation of A Networked Collaboration Engine for Virtual Engineering of Tilting Train)

  • 정유진;한성호;송용수
    • 시스템엔지니어링학술지
    • /
    • 제2권2호
    • /
    • pp.45-50
    • /
    • 2006
  • Tilting technology is to tilt the train on the curve in order to minimize centrifugal force to passengers and to improve the speed within the limits of passenger's comfort and safety. According to reports from other countries, there is 15~30% speed improvement compared to the conventional trains. Recently, the advent of World-Wide-Web(WWW) and the explosive popularity of the Internet gave birth to collaborative applications which were enabled by computers and networks as their primary media. The progress of 3D computer graphics enabled collaborative applications with 3D virtual environments or distributed virtual environments. In this paper, we explain our implementation of the Share collaboration engine which is for collaboration applications based on a distributed virtual environment. The Share collaboration engine proposes a new Share network architecture for management of participants, and it provides some synchronization methods for 3D objects in virtual collaboration. TTX_PDM is an experimental application that tries to prevent wastes of human, material and time resources in networked virtual collaboration.

  • PDF